Initial Damage Assessment and Documentation
The first step is a thorough inspection using specialized equipment. We’ll document the full extent of the damage, which is crucial for your insurance claim. This phase helps us create a precise plan for restoration. You’ll understand exactly what needs to be done.
Water Extraction and Containment
We use powerful truck-mounted extraction units to remove standing water quickly. Then, we set up containment barriers to prevent moisture from spreading further. This step is vital for controlling the damage and protecting unaffected areas. It stops the problem from getting worse.
Drying and Dehumidification
Industrial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ers are deployed to thoroughly dry affected materials. We monitor humidity levels closely to ensure optimal drying conditions. This process can take several days, depending on the severity and building materials. Proper drying prevents mold growth.
Mold and Odor Removal
If mold has started to grow, our certified technicians will safely remove it. We also use specialized equipment to neutralize any lingering odors. Restoring a healthy environment is a top priority. We want your building to smell fresh again.
Reconstruction and Rebuilding
Once everything is dry and clean, we begin the reconstruction phase. This could involve repairing drywall, replacing flooring, or restoring damaged fixtures. Our goal is to return your building to its pre-damage condition. You’ll be happy with the final result.

Warning Signs You Need College & University Damage Restoration
Catching damage early is key to minimizing costs and preventing more serious issues. Ignoring these signs can lead to expensive structural repairs and health hazards. It’s always better to be safe than sorry when it comes to your facilities. We’ve seen the consequences of delayed action.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Persistent musty smells, especially in basements, common areas, or HVAC systems, are often a sign of hidden mold growth. This indicates moisture problems that need immediate attention. Don’t let these odors linger.
Visible Water Stains or Discoloration
Water spots on ceilings, walls, or floors are clear indicators of a leak or past water intrusion. These marks mean moisture has penetrated materials. They require professional assessment to find the source and dry out the area.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per
This often happens when moisture gets behind the surface. It weakens adhesives and damages the material. It’s a visual cue that something is wrong behind the scenes. We can fix these cosmetic issues.
Warped or Sagging Ceilings and Walls
Structural materials absorbing too much water can begin to deform. This is a serious sign that the integrity of your building could be compromised. It requires immediate professional intervention. Safety is paramount.
Soft or Spongy Flooring Materials
Carpet, wood, or tile that feels soft or gives way when walked on suggests significant moisture saturation underneath. This can lead to mold and structural decay. It’s a clear sign of trouble.
Increased Humidity Levels
If rooms feel unusually damp or clammy, it might signal an undetected leak or a problem with your building’s moisture management. Consistently high humidity can foster mold growth. We can help identify the cause.
College & University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Minor condensation on a window | Yes, wipe it down. | No. | This is usually not a sign of a larger problem. |
| Small, isolated water stain on a wall | Maybe, if very small and dry. | Yes. | You need to find the source and ensure it’s fully dried to prevent mold. |
| A flooded restroom with standing water | No. | Yes. | Large amounts of water require professional extraction equipment and drying. |
| Musty smell in a dorm room hallway | No, investigate immediately. | Yes. | This likely indicates hidden mold that needs expert remediation. |
| Leaking pipe in a mechanical room | No. | Yes. | These areas often have complex plumbing and electrical systems requiring specialized knowledge. |
| Water damage after a sprinkler system malfunction | No. | Yes. | Large-scale water events need rapid, industrial-level drying and dehumidification. |
While minor incidents might seem manageable, any significant water intrusion or suspected mold growth on a college campus warrants professional attention. What are the health risks of ignoring water damage in a university setting?
Ignoring water damage can lead to significant health risks, primarily due to mold growth. Mold spores can cause respiratory problems, allergic reactions, and exacerbate existing conditions like asthma, especially in densely populated environments like dorms or classrooms.
